Enjoy this affordable, ski-in/ski-out slopeside property that allows you to enjoy the amenities of the Breckenridge ski area and Peak 8 right from your door.  You can’t beat the slopeside location during ski season, making the trip from your condo to the Colorado and Rocky Mountain high-speed quad-chair lifts in minutes. It is easy to make 'first tracks' in the fresh powder since you're staying on the main slopes. If you want to experience the hustle and bustle of downtown, it’s just a mile away. When visiting Skiwatch in the summer, you can take advantage of the close mountain biking and hiking trails as well as the Peak 8 Fun Park. When you come back to the condo, you'll truly appreciate the quiet mountain setting.

Skiwatch has ski/snowboard lockers on site, as well as a sauna and two large slopeside hot tubs that you can relax in after a long day on the slopes. This property also accommodates two vehicles per condo, includes onsite laundry, and has elevator access to our 4 floors of units.  For your convenience, we have added a secure wireless high-speed cable internet network to the building, which you can enjoy in one of the common rooms or your rented unit.  The Skiwatch complex is small, private, and provides onsite building management, so we are available at a moment's notice.  

The living room has a beautiful stone gas-log fireplace and beautiful wooded views out the balcony sliding glass door. The kitchen is fully-equipped with a microwave, stove, dishwasher, fridge, and all the utensils and dishes that you may need to feed your group for any occasion.

Location, Location, Location
Ski Watch offers a true ski-in, ski-out experience sitting 100 yards above the Peak 8 base. Enjoy two hot tubs over looking the slopes as well. Although unit 438 has not been updated, it's very clean and priced accordingly. Both downstairs bedrooms have matching queen beds which provided more sleeping options for our group versus a traditional king in the master. The upstairs loft with queens was great, but not having a door for privacy and quiet may be an issue for some. Highly recommend if you are looking for location, budget considerations and a large group.
